文件名称:JSurfaceNets:基于 SurfaceNets 的等值面提取和 CSG
文件大小:58KB
文件格式:ZIP
更新时间:2024-07-09 08:07:43
Java
JSurfaceNets 基于 SurfaceNets 的等值面提取和 CSG 基于 Mikola Lysenko 的看起来有点吓人、紧凑且高效的 JavaScript 实现,该实现基于:SF Gibson,“受约束的弹性表面网络”。 (1998) MERL 技术报告。 与论文中描述的方法唯一不同的是,该算法选择表面上边缘交叉点的平均点作为四边形网格生成的单元坐标。 这效果出奇的好! 在许多情况下,此算法是行进立方体算法的良好替代品。 此实现还可用于通过替换“平均点”代码来创建更智能的对偶方法。 此外,该实现还带有简单的 CSG 支持(联合、差异和交集)。 网格可以保存为 *.obj-File。
【文件预览】:
JSurfaceNets-master
----.gitignore(20B)
----gradle()
--------wrapper()
----README.md(836B)
----build.gradle(1KB)
----gradlew.bat(2KB)
----gradlew(5KB)
----src()
--------main()
----settings.gradle(34B)